Job Summary:

The Registered Nurse is a practitioner who is responsible for assessing, planning, implementing, and evaluating nursing care for an identified group of patients in an inpatient environment. This individual demonstrates competency in delivery of care to a primarily adult population. The Staff RN-Inpatient job description has incorporated essential functions which are adapted from the ANA Nursing: Scope and Standards of Practice. Other duties as assigned.

Other information:

EXPERIENCE REQUIRED: Clinical competence and experience in the care and management of target patient populations specific to area of employment. EXPERIENCE PREFERRED: None. EDUCATION REQUIRED: Professional knowledge of nursing theory and practice at a level normally acquired through completion of education at an accredited School of Nursing in order to be eligible for licensure as a Registered Nurse is required. Upon hire any non-BSN nurse with less than one year of licensed registered nurse experience will be required to enroll in a BSN (or higher nursing degree) program. Acceptance into a program is expected within 15 months of hire and the degree program must be completed within 5 years of enrollment, or 6 years if program is MSN, DNP or PhD in Nursing. EDUCATION PREFERRED: Bachelor's Degree in Nursing is preferred. TRAINING REQUIRED: None. TRAINING PREFERRED: None. SPECIAL SKILLS REQUIRED: None. SPECIAL SKILLS PREFERRED: None. LICENSURE REQUIRED: Requires current state of Wisconsin Registered Nurse License or a Multi-state Nursing License from a participating state in the NLC (Nurse Licensure Compact). American Heart Association (AHA) Basic Life Support for the Healthcare Provider (BLS) or an AHA approved equivalent is required within 90 days of hire. American Academy of Pediatric (AAP) Neonatal Resuscitation Program (NRP) is required within one year of hire. Electronic Fetal Monitoring certification through the National Certification Corporation (NCC) is required within 18 months from date of hire. LICENSURE PREFERRED: None.

The Froedtert & the Medical College of Wisconsin regional health network is a partnership between Froedtert Health and the Medical College of Wisconsin supporting a shared mission of patient care, innovation, medical research and education. Our health network operates eastern Wisconsin's only academic medical center and adult Level I Trauma center engaged in thousands of clinical trials and studies. The Froedtert & MCW health network, which includes ten hospitals, nearly 2,000 physicians and more than 45 health centers and clinics draw patients from throughout the Midwest and the nation.
